CBFC’s Review and Changes
Bhooth Bangla received a U/A 16+ rating from the CBFC, but not without some required modifications. The Examining Committee identified several instances of inappropriate language and content that needed to be addressed. Specifically, an obscene word was replaced at the 26-minute mark, while additional offensive language was flagged for removal about an hour into the film. Furthermore, a derogatory reference to women in the first half was also mandated to be altered. The committee requested disclaimers to be added for any religious and superstitious references present in the film.
After implementing these changes, the filmmakers received their censor certificate on April 2. The official runtime of the film, as stated on the certificate, is 174.57 minutes, translating to approximately 2 hours and 54 minutes. Notably, Bollywood Hungama was the first to report that the film was expected to have a runtime close to 170 minutes.
Voluntary Cuts and Final Runtime
In a recent development, the team behind Bhooth Bangla approached the CBFC again to propose voluntary cuts to the film. The board accepted these adjustments on April 11. The filmmakers trimmed a total of 63 scenes, with some cuts being as brief as one second. The most significant cut was a 72-second deletion from the song “O Sundari.” Additionally, 27 seconds were removed from another song, “O Re O Sawariya.”
As a result of these voluntary edits, the film’s total runtime has been reduced by 10 minutes and 5 seconds. The revised length now stands at 164.52 minutes, or approximately 2 hours and 44 minutes.
